What is the maximum daily dose and duration for trifluoperazine in short-term anxiety management?

Explanation:
Trifluoperazine is a high-potency typical antipsychotic, and when used for anxiety the aim is to achieve symptom relief with the smallest effective dose for the shortest possible time. The risks of extrapyramidal symptoms, tardive dyskinesia, and other adverse effects rise with both higher doses and longer use. Therefore, the safest, most practical guideline for short-term anxiety management is a maximum of 6 mg per day, with treatment not extending beyond about 12 weeks. If there isn’t adequate benefit within this window or if side effects appear, it’s better to reassess rather than push the dose higher or continue longer. Lower doses or shorter durations may be used in milder cases or in patients with higher risk for movement disorders, but the combination of 6 mg/day and up to 12 weeks represents the balance between potential benefit and risk for this medication in this setting.
